Is clothing considered ritually pure if it has been touched by water used to wash away impurity, but it is unknown whether this water has changed (its characteristics) or not?
If you doubt the impurity of water that has separated from the washing of an impurity, then what touches clothes from it does not render them impure. The fundamental principle regarding things is purity, and their impurity is not to be declared except with certainty.
